Selecting the Correct Stainless Steel Pipe Fittings
Choosing the right stainless steel conduit fittings is critical for ensuring a durable and leak-proof system. Consider several factors including the grade of stainless steel required—typically 304 or 316—based on the system's environmental exposure. In addition, the pressure ratings of the components must be aligned with the overall system requirements. Wrong selection can lead to significant malfunctions.
Here's a quick look at some key points :
- Steel Grade : Match the proper stainless steel grade for the particular purpose.
- Pressure Capacities : Check that the components can handle the highest pressure levels .
- Connection Configuration: Pick the necessary fitting configuration (e.g., bends , crosses , unions ).
- Dimension : Make certain the size of the fittings are exactly matched to the pipes .
Stainless Steel Buttweld Fittings: Types & Applications
Stainless metal buttweld components are vital elements in piping systems, providing a secure and watertight joint between pipes. These connectors are typically used where welding is required to create a permanent connection. Common varieties include radii, manifolds, adapters, ends, and olets, several manufactured to resist specific load and temperature requirements. Applications are extensive across fields such as industrial manufacturing, oil plus gas extraction, energy generation, and the healthcare industry. Their corrosion immunity makes them ideal for conveying aggressive materials.
- Elbows: Applied to change the path of movement.
- Tees: Offer a branch point in the system.
- Reducers: Reduce the size of a tube.
- Caps: Terminate the end of a tube.

QA for Steel Butt Connectors
Ensuring superior standard for stainless steel butt connectors requires a rigorous quality assurance program . This includes detailed examination for flaws, followed by non-destructive testing such as radiography, ultrasonic inspection , and dye check to uncover any subsurface faults. Accurate measurements are likewise verified during the manufacturing procedure , assuring reliability and function under service conditions .
